apache-spark - spark2-submit 与 spark-submit 不同
问题描述
spark2-submit 与 spark 提交有何不同。我需要从我的代码迁移我spark 1.6 to spark 2.4
仍然可以使用 spark-submit 来启动我的应用程序还是必须迁移到 spark2-submit。
解决方案
设置以下环境变量后,您可以对 Spark 2.X 使用 spark-submit:
1) SPARK_HOME 到 spark2-client 的路径(例如 /usr/hdp/current/spark2-client) 2) SPARK_MAJOR_VERSION=2
使用这两种配置,即使您在集群上同时安装了 Spark 1.x 和 Spark 2.x,您也可以使用 Spark 2.x 通过相同的命令(如 spark-shell、spark-submit)运行作业
推荐阅读
- java - 如何使用 thymleaf 填充下拉菜单?
- javascript - Why Is This "OnScroll" JavaScript Function Not Being Called?
- powershell - 查找外部角色的成员
- python - 使用 Python 的 BigQuery 动态 SQL
- git - git rebase 被错误的先前合并阻止 - 可以修复吗?
- android - 如何在不禁用可折叠设备支持的情况下禁用 resizeableActivity
- python - 在 Python 中寻找关于如何让我的 while 循环中断的建议
- python - 电源中遇到的无效值
- javafx - 如何使 JavaFX 窗格适应其内容的大小?
- java - 横幅广告事件 (java)